Twin brothers from Georgia have mysteriously died and their family wants answers.
According to reports, the twins, Qaadir and Nazzir Lewis, 19, were set to head to Boston to meet their friends, however, they missed their 7 am flight, the family said. It was around 11 am that police informed the family that the boys were found dead on the top of Bell Mountain in Hiawasee, GA.
The Georgia Bureua of Investigation revealed that the boys were shot to death and that their plane tickets were still in their wallets. The family is questioning how did they end up in that area since they were unfamiliar with the area.
“How did they end up out in the mountains? They don’t hike out there, they’ve never been out there. They don’t know anything about Hiawassee, Georgia. They never even heard of Bell Mountain, so how did they end up right there?”
The GBI ruled their deaths a murder-suicide, however the autopsy results are still pending. The family also stated that the twins were inseparable and never had any conflicts with each other. “They’re very protective of each other. They love each other,” their uncle, Rahim Brawner said. “They’re inseparable. I couldn’t imagine them hurting each other because I’ve never seen them get into a fistfight before.”
